Build Logs

yrichika/scalahtml • 3.8.0-RC3:2025-12-04

Errors

1

Warnings

2

Total Lines

379

1##################################
2Clonning https://github.com/yrichika/scalahtml.git into /build/repo using revision
3##################################
4----
5Preparing build for 3.8.0-RC3
6Scala binary version found: 3.8
7Implicitly using source version 3.8
8Scala binary version found: 3.8
9Implicitly using source version 3.8
10Would try to apply common scalacOption (best-effort, sbt/mill only):
11Append: ,REQUIRE:-source:3.8
12Remove: ,-deprecation,-feature,-Xfatal-warnings,-Werror,MATCH:.*-Wconf.*any:e
13----
14Starting build for 3.8.0-RC3
15Execute tests: true
16sbt project found:
17grep: /build/repo/project/plugins.sbt: No such file or directory
18Sbt version 1.5.5 is not supported, minimal supported version is 1.11.5
19Enforcing usage of sbt in version 1.11.5
20No prepare script found for project yrichika/scalahtml
21##################################
22Scala version: 3.8.0-RC3
23Targets: io.github.yrichika%scalahtml
24Project projectConfig: {"tests":null}
25##################################
26Using extra scalacOptions: ,REQUIRE:-source:3.8
27Filtering out scalacOptions: ,-deprecation,-feature,-Xfatal-warnings,-Werror,MATCH:.*-Wconf.*any:e
28[sbt_options] declare -a sbt_options=()
29[process_args] java_version = '17'
30[copyRt] java9_rt = '/root/.sbt/1.0/java9-rt-ext-eclipse_adoptium_17_0_8/rt.jar'
31# Executing command line:
32java
33-Dfile.encoding=UTF-8
34-Dcommunitybuild.scala=3.8.0-RC3
35-Dcommunitybuild.project.dependencies.add=
36-Xmx7G
37-Xms4G
38-Xss8M
39-Dsbt.script=/root/.sdkman/candidates/sbt/current/bin/sbt
40-Dscala.ext.dirs=/root/.sbt/1.0/java9-rt-ext-eclipse_adoptium_17_0_8
41-jar
42/root/.sdkman/candidates/sbt/1.11.5/bin/sbt-launch.jar
43"setCrossScalaVersions 3.8.0-RC3"
44"++3.8.0-RC3 -v"
45"mapScalacOptions ",REQUIRE:-source:3.8,-Wconf:msg=can be rewritten automatically under:s" ",-deprecation,-feature,-Xfatal-warnings,-Werror,MATCH:.*-Wconf.*any:e""
46"set every credentials := Nil"
47"excludeLibraryDependency com.github.ghik:zerowaste_{scalaVersion} com.olegpy:better-monadic-for_3 org.polyvariant:better-tostring_{scalaVersion} org.wartremover:wartremover_{scalaVersion}"
48"removeScalacOptionsStartingWith -P:wartremover"
49
50moduleMappings
51"runBuild 3.8.0-RC3 """{"tests":null}""" io.github.yrichika%scalahtml"
52
53[info] welcome to sbt 1.11.5 (Eclipse Adoptium Java 17.0.8)
54[info] loading settings for project repo-build from akka.sbt, plugins.sbt...
55[info] loading project definition from /build/repo/project
56[info] compiling 2 Scala sources to /build/repo/project/target/scala-2.12/sbt-1.0/classes ...
57[info] Non-compiled module 'compiler-bridge_2.12' for Scala 2.12.20. Compiling...
58[info] Compilation completed in 8.987s.
59[info] done compiling
60[info] loading settings for project repo from build.sbt...
61[info] set current project to scalahtml (in build file:/build/repo/)
62Execute setCrossScalaVersions: 3.8.0-RC3
63OpenCB::Changing crossVersion 3.0.1 -> 3.8.0-RC3 in repo/crossScalaVersions
64[info] set current project to scalahtml (in build file:/build/repo/)
65[info] Setting Scala version to 3.8.0-RC3 on 1 projects.
66[info] Switching Scala version on:
67[info] * repo (2.13.5, 3.8.0-RC3)
68[info] Excluding projects:
69[info] Reapplying settings...
70[info] set current project to scalahtml (in build file:/build/repo/)
71Execute mapScalacOptions: ,REQUIRE:-source:3.8,-Wconf:msg=can be rewritten automatically under:s ,-deprecation,-feature,-Xfatal-warnings,-Werror,MATCH:.*-Wconf.*any:e
72[info] Reapplying settings...
73[info] set current project to scalahtml (in build file:/build/repo/)
74[info] Defining Global / credentials, credentials
75[info] The new values will be used by allCredentials, credentials and 2 others.
76[info] Run `last` for details.
77[info] Reapplying settings...
78[info] set current project to scalahtml (in build file:/build/repo/)
79Execute excludeLibraryDependency: com.github.ghik:zerowaste_{scalaVersion} com.olegpy:better-monadic-for_3 org.polyvariant:better-tostring_{scalaVersion} org.wartremover:wartremover_{scalaVersion}
80[info] Reapplying settings...
81OpenCB::Failed to reapply settings in excludeLibraryDependency: Reference to undefined setting:
82
83 Global / allExcludeDependencies from Global / allExcludeDependencies (CommunityBuildPlugin.scala:331)
84 Did you mean allExcludeDependencies ?
85 , retry without global scopes
86[info] Reapplying settings...
87[info] set current project to scalahtml (in build file:/build/repo/)
88Execute removeScalacOptionsStartingWith: -P:wartremover
89[info] Reapplying settings...
90[info] set current project to scalahtml (in build file:/build/repo/)
91[success] Total time: 0 s, completed Dec 4, 2025, 12:44:39 PM
92Build config: {"tests":null}
93Parsed config: Failure(sjsonnew.DeserializationException: Expected String as JString, but got JNull)
94Starting build...
95Projects: Set(repo)
96Starting build for ProjectRef(file:/build/repo/,repo) (scalahtml)... [0/1]
97OpenCB::Exclude Scala3 specific scalacOption `REQUIRE:-source:3.8` in Scala 2.12.20 module Global
98Compile scalacOptions: -Wconf:msg=can be rewritten automatically under:s, -source:3.8
99[info] compiling 1 Scala source to /build/repo/target/scala-3.8.0-RC3/classes ...
100[info] done compiling
101[info] compiling 4 Scala sources to /build/repo/target/scala-3.8.0-RC3/test-classes ...
102[warn] there was 1 deprecation warning; re-run with -deprecation for details
103[warn] one warning found
104[info] done compiling
105[info] TestCase:
106[info] TagsSpec:
107[info] comment
108[info] - should retrn html comment string
109[info] doctypeHtml
110[info] - should return html5 doctype tag string
111[info] doctype
112[info] - should return doctype tag string
113[info] a
114[info] - should return a tag string with content
115[info] abbr
116[info] - should return abbr tag string with content
117[info] address
118[info] - should return address tag string with content
119[info] area
120[info] - should return area tag string with content
121[info] article
122[info] - should return article tag string with content
123[info] aside
124[info] - should return aside tag string with content
125[info] audio
126[info] - should return audio tag string with content
127[info] b
128[info] - should return b tag string with content
129[info] base
130[info] - should return base tag string with content
131[info] bdi
132[info] - should return bdi tag string with content
133[info] bdo
134[info] - should return bdo tag string with content
135[info] blockquote
136[info] - should return blockquote tag string with content
137[info] body
138[info] - should return body tag string with content
139[info] br
140[info] - should return br tag string with content
141[info] button
142[info] - should return button tag string with content
143[info] canvas
144[info] - should return canvas tag string with content
145[info] caption
146[info] - should return caption tag string with content
147[info] cite
148[info] - should return cite tag string with content
149[info] code
150[info] - should return code tag string with content
151[info] col
152[info] - should return col tag string with content
153[info] colgroup
154[info] - should return colgroup tag string with content
155[info] data
156[info] - should return data tag string with content
157[info] datalist
158[info] - should return datalist tag string with content
159[info] dd
160[info] - should return dd tag string with content
161[info] del
162[info] - should return del tag string with content
163[info] details
164[info] - should return details tag string with content
165[info] dfn
166[info] - should return dfn tag string with content
167[info] dialog
168[info] - should return dialog tag string with content
169[info] div
170[info] - should return div tag string with content
171[info] dl
172[info] - should return dl tag string with content
173[info] dt
174[info] - should return dt tag string with content
175[info] em
176[info] - should return em tag string with content
177[info] embed
178[info] - should return embed tag string with content
179[info] fieldset
180[info] - should return fieldset tag string with content
181[info] figcaption
182[info] - should return figcaption tag string with content
183[info] figure
184[info] - should return figure tag string with content
185[info] footer
186[info] - should return footer tag string with content
187[info] form
188[info] - should return form tag string with content
189[info] h1
190[info] - should return h1 tag string with content
191[info] h2
192[info] - should return h2 tag string with content
193[info] h3
194[info] - should return h3 tag string with content
195[info] h4
196[info] - should return h4 tag string with content
197[info] h5
198[info] - should return h5 tag string with content
199[info] h6
200[info] - should return h6 tag string with content
201[info] head
202[info] - should return head tag string with content
203[info] header
204[info] - should return header tag string with content
205[info] hr
206[info] - should return hr tag string with content
207[info] html
208[info] - should return html tag string with content
209[info] html5
210[info] - should return html5 tag string with content
211[info] i
212[info] - should return i tag string with content
213[info] iframe
214[info] - should return iframe tag string with content
215[info] img
216[info] - should return img tag string with content
217[info] input
218[info] - should return input tag string with content
219[info] ins
220[info] - should return ins tag string with content
221[info] kbd
222[info] - should return kbd tag string with content
223[info] label
224[info] - should return label tag string with content
225[info] legend
226[info] - should return legend tag string with content
227[info] li
228[info] - should return li tag string with content
229[info] link
230[info] - should return link tag string with content
231[info] main
232[info] - should return main tag string with content
233[info] main_
234[info] - should return main tag string with content
235[info] map
236[info] - should return map tag string with content
237[info] mark
238[info] - should return mark tag string with content
239[info] meta
240[info] - should return meta tag string with content
241[info] meter
242[info] - should return meter tag string with content
243[info] nav
244[info] - should return nav tag string with content
245[info] noscript
246[info] - should return noscript tag string with content
247[info] object_
248[info] - should return object_ tag string with content
249[info] ol
250[info] - should return ol tag string with content
251[info] optgroup
252[info] - should return optgroup tag string with content
253[info] option
254[info] - should return option tag string with content
255[info] output
256[info] - should return output tag string with content
257[info] p
258[info] - should return p tag string with content
259[info] param
260[info] - should return param tag string with content
261[info] picture
262[info] - should return picture tag string with content
263[info] pre
264[info] - should return pre tag string with content
265[info] progress
266[info] - should return progress tag string with content
267[info] q
268[info] - should return q tag string with content
269[info] rp
270[info] - should return rp tag string with content
271[info] rt
272[info] - should return rt tag string with content
273[info] ruby
274[info] - should return ruby tag string with content
275[info] s
276[info] - should return s tag string with content
277[info] samp
278[info] - should return samp tag string with content
279[info] script
280[info] - should return script tag string with content
281[info] section
282[info] - should return section tag string with content
283[info] select
284[info] - should return select tag string with content
285[info] small
286[info] - should return small tag string with content
287[info] source
288[info] - should return source tag string with content
289[info] span
290[info] - should return span tag string with content
291[info] strong
292[info] - should return strong tag string with content
293[info] style
294[info] - should return style tag string with content
295[info] sub
296[info] - should return sub tag string with content
297[info] summary
298[info] - should return summary tag string with content
299[info] sup
300[info] - should return sup tag string with content
301[info] svg
302[info] - should return svg tag string with content
303[info] table
304[info] - should return table tag string with content
305[info] tbody
306[info] - should return tbody tag string with content
307[info] td
308[info] - should return td tag string with content
309[info] template
310[info] - should return template tag string with content
311[info] textarea
312[info] - should return textarea tag string with content
313[info] tfoot
314[info] - should return tfoot tag string with content
315[info] th
316[info] - should return th tag string with content
317[info] thead
318[info] - should return thead tag string with content
319[info] time
320[info] - should return time tag string with content
321[info] title
322[info] - should return title tag string with content
323[info] tr
324[info] - should return tr tag string with content
325[info] track
326[info] - should return track tag string with content
327[info] u
328[info] - should return u tag string with content
329[info] ul
330[info] - should return ul tag string with content
331[info] var_
332[info] - should return var_ tag string with content
333[info] video
334[info] - should return video tag string with content
335[info] wbr
336[info] - should return wbr tag string with content
337[info] tag
338[info] - should generate any named tag
339[info] selfClosingTag
340[info] - should generate self-closing any named tag
341[info] - should with end slash if hasEndSlash parameter is true
342[info] tagSelf
343[info] - should generate self-closing any named tag
344[info] - should with end slash if hasEndSlash parameter is true
345[info] generateTag
346[info] - should generate tag with content
347[info] - should generate tag with attributes if given
348[info] generateSelfClosingTag
349[info] - should generate self-closing tag
350[info] - should add end slash if hasEndSlash parameter true
351[info] - should generate tag with attributes if given
352[info] attributesMapToString
353[info] - should convert Map to tag attribute string
354[info] - should create attribute with no value if Map has empty key
355[info] - should create attribute with no value if Map has empty value
356[info] \\
357[info] - should concatenate strings
358[info] toHtmlDocument
359[info] - should convert html string to jsoup Document
360
361************************
362Build summary:
363[{
364 "module": "scalahtml",
365 "compile": {"status": "ok", "tookMs": 7268, "warnings": 0, "errors": 0, "sourceVersion": "3.8"},
366 "doc": {"status": "skipped", "tookMs": 0, "files": 0, "totalSizeKb": 0},
367 "test-compile": {"status": "ok", "tookMs": 7619, "warnings": 0, "errors": 0, "sourceVersion": "3.8"},
368 "test": {"status": "ok", "tookMs": 834, "passed": 130, "failed": 0, "ignored": 0, "skipped": 0, "total": 130, "byFramework": [{"framework": "unknown", "stats": {"passed": 130, "failed": 0, "ignored": 0, "skipped": 0, "total": 130}}]},
369 "publish": {"status": "skipped", "tookMs": 0},
370 "metadata": {
371 "crossScalaVersions": ["2.13.5", "3.0.1"]
372}
373}]
374************************
375[success] Total time: 27 s, completed Dec 4, 2025, 12:45:06 PM
376[0JChecking patch project/build.properties...
377Checking patch build.sbt...
378Applied patch project/build.properties cleanly.
379Applied patch build.sbt cleanly.